Which function has a minimum and is transformed to the right and down from the parent function, f(x) = x2? g(x) = –9(x + 1)2 – 7
zalisa [80]

Answer:

g(x) = 8\cdot (x-3)^{2}-5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that parent function represents a parabola, the standard form with a vertex at (h,k) is now described:

y-k = C\cdot (x-h)^{2}

y = C \cdot (x-h)^{2} + k

Where:

x, y - Independent and dependent variables, dimensionless.

h, k - Horizontal and vertical component of the vertex, dimensionless.

C - Vertex factor, dimensionless. (If C > 0, then vertex is an absolute minimum, but if C < 0, there is an absolute maximum).

After reading the statement of the problem, the following conclusion are found:

1) New function must have an absolute minimum: C > 0

2) Transformation to the right: h > 0.

3) Transformation downwards: k < 0

Hence, the right choice must be g(x) = 8\cdot (x-3)^{2}-5.
